Bitcoin Struggles Below $64,000 as Sellers Regain Control
The Bitcoin price has been struggling to break above $64,000, and sellers have taken control of the market. The recent bounce from $63,260 stalled right around the $64,000 mark, indicating that buyers are still hesitant to push prices higher.
The immediate outlook for Bitcoin leans bearish, with a moderate bearish advantage according to the prediction score of -4 out of +10. The current bias is in a bearish repair phase, not yet a confirmed bullish reversal.
Traders are advised to wait for a failed rebound or a confirmed breakdown before shorting the market. Shorting directly into major support carries a poor risk-to-reward ratio and may lead to losses.
